History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on September 30
Year | Event |
---|---|
1863 | Georges Bizet's opera Les pêcheurs de perles, premiered in Paris. |
1882 | Thomas Edison's first commercial hydroelectric power plant (later known as Appleton Edison Light Company) begins operation. |
1888 | Jack the Ripper kills his third and fourth victims, Elizabeth Stride and Catherine Eddowes. |
1906 | The Royal Galician Academy, the Galician language's biggest linguistic authority, starts working in La Coruña, Spain. |
1907 | The McKinley National Memorial, the final resting place of assassinated U.S. President William McKinley and his family, is dedicated in Canton, Ohio. |
1909 | The Cunard Line's RMS Mauretania makes a record-breaking westbound crossing of the Atlantic, that will not be bettered for 20 years. |
1915 | World War I: Radoje Ljutovac becomes the first soldier in history to shoot down an enemy aircraft with ground-to-air fire. |
1918 | Ukrainian War of Independence: Insurgent forces led by Nestor Makhno defeat the Central Powers at the battle of Dibrivka. |
1935 | The Hoover Dam, astride the border between the U.S. states of Arizona and Nevada, is dedicated. |
1938 | Britain, France, Germany and Italy sign the Munich Agreement, whereby Germany annexes the Sudetenland region of Czechoslovakia. |
